Thread
:
X-Men: The Last Stand
View Single Post
#
11
Spectre X
Rating: Yes.
Join Date: Feb 2003
Location: Dutchland
Mar 10th, 2006, 07:36 PM
it aired in Britain.
Also on the inter nets
__________________
Quote:
Originally Posted by
Chojin
everybody knows that pterodactyls hate the screech of a guitar :o
Spectre X
View Public Profile
Send a private message to Spectre X
Find all posts by Spectre X